In a large cast-iron Dutch oven or heavy-bottomed pot heated over medium-high heat, add the olive oil.
Once the oil is hot, add the ground beef. Cook until browned, about 5-7 minutes, breaking it into crumbles with a wooden spoon. Drain any excess grease if necessary.
Add the diced onion, green bell pepper, and minced garlic to the pot. Sauté until the vegetables are softened, about 5 minutes.
Stir in the chili powder, ground cumin, smoked paprika, cayenne pepper, salt, and black pepper. Cook for 1 minute to toast the spices and release their aromas.
Add the tomato paste and stir to coat the meat and vegetables. Cook for another 1-2 minutes.
Pour in the canned diced tomatoes (with their juices), beef broth, kidney beans, and black beans. Stir to combine.
Bring the mixture to a gentle boil, then reduce the heat to low and allow the chili to simmer uncovered for 45 minutes, stirring occasionally. This allows the flavors to meld and the chili to thicken.
Taste the chili and adjust seasonings as desired. You can add more salt, pepper, or chili powder for extra flavor.
Serve hot with your choice of toppings such as shredded cheese, sour cream, chopped green onions, or crushed tortilla chips.
